Output 7596df350b9a8ad061567909ca67cfa6c0eee195125444d089cf2e70f03cb94f:1

value
51308169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ae44669a1ab41d74ff8b38f684e823213b602a6 OP_EQUAL
address
374QaVrt6HMjUm84EKV1AChPqCswUfWJre
transaction
7596df350b9a8ad061567909ca67cfa6c0eee195125444d089cf2e70f03cb94f